Plugin Minecraft EssentialsAntiBuild
Informasi tentang EssentialsAntiBuild dan server tempat ditemukan
🔌 Tentang AntiBuild
AntiBuild (didistribusikan sebagai modul AntiBuild Essentials/EssentialsX) adalah modul plugin Minecraft yang mengekstrak dan memperluas fungsi "antibuild" dari paket Essentials. Modul ini memberi administrator server kontrol yang terperinci dan berbasis izin atas blok dan item mana yang boleh ditempatkan, dihancurkan, digunakan, dibuat, dipungut, atau dibuang oleh pemain.
🎯 Tujuan
AntiBuild menyelesaikan masalah interaksi blok/item yang tidak diinginkan dan griefing yang ditargetkan dengan memungkinkan operator membatasi aksi per item dan per blok. Ini berguna saat Anda membutuhkan aturan berbasis izin yang terpusat untuk perilaku membangun dan interaksi, bukan hanya perlindungan berbasis region.
⚙️ Fitur
- Blacklist seluruh server untuk menempatkan, menghancurkan, menggunakan, dan menggerakkan blok tertentu dengan piston.
- Blacklist penggunaan item untuk memblokir interaksi item tertentu.
- Aturan izinkan/tolak berbasis izin untuk place/break/interact/craft/pickup/drop berdasarkan ID/nama item per item.
- Dukungan legacy untuk sintaks blacklist lama (ID) dan transisi ke nama item pada versi Minecraft modern.
- Sistem peringatan build untuk memberi tahu staf saat item tertentu ditempatkan, digunakan, atau dihancurkan.
- Izin global opt-out untuk mengecualikan pengguna tepercaya dari pemeriksaan demi mengurangi overhead runtime.
🧩 Untuk Siapa
- Server Survival/SMP kecil hingga besar dan server publik yang membutuhkan pembatasan per item/build.
- Server yang sudah menggunakan Essentials/EssentialsX dan menginginkan fitur antibuild modular.
- Administrator yang lebih suka kontrol berbasis izin daripada perlindungan berbasis region untuk item tertentu.
🏗️ Contoh Penggunaan
- Mencegah pemain menempatkan TNT, piston, atau blok lain yang berdampak pada server sambil tetap mengizinkan pembangunan biasa.
- Memblokir penggunaan item tertentu (misalnya flint and steel) sambil tetap membiarkan yang lain membangun.
- Memberi tahu staf saat seorang pemain menempatkan atau berinteraksi dengan item yang dipantau.
🔐 Izin
| Permission | Description | Default |
|---|---|---|
essentials.build | Opt-out global: pengguna dikecualikan dari pemeriksaan AntiBuild. | tidak ditentukan |
essentials.protect.exemptplacement | Mengecualikan pemain dari blacklist penempatan. | tidak ditentukan |
essentials.protect.exemptusage | Mengecualikan pemain dari blacklist penggunaan. | tidak ditentukan |
essentials.protect.exemptbreak | Mengecualikan pemain dari blacklist penghancuran. | tidak ditentukan |
essentials.protect.alerts | Menerima peringatan staf saat item yang dipantau terpicu. | tidak ditentukan |
essentials.protect.alerts.notrigger | Mengecualikan pemain dari memicu notifikasi peringatan. | tidak ditentukan |
essentials.build.place.<id> | Mengizinkan penempatan item/blok tertentu berdasarkan id (atau nama). | tidak ditentukan |
essentials.build.break.<id> | Mengizinkan penghancuran item/blok tertentu berdasarkan id (atau nama). | tidak ditentukan |
essentials.build.interact.<id> | Mengizinkan interaksi dengan item/blok tertentu berdasarkan id (atau nama). | tidak ditentukan |
essentials.build.craft.<id> | Mengizinkan pembuatan item tertentu berdasarkan id (atau nama). | tidak ditentukan |
essentials.build.pickup.<id> | Mengizinkan mengambil item tertentu berdasarkan id (atau nama). | tidak ditentukan |
essentials.build.drop.<id> | Mengizinkan menjatuhkan item tertentu berdasarkan id (atau nama). | tidak ditentukan |
Catatan: plugin mendukung varian izin wildcard dan per-datavalue (misalnya essentials.build.* atau essentials.build.place.54:*) seperti yang didokumentasikan oleh modul.
⚙️ Instalasi
📥 Penyiapan
- Dapatkan modul AntiBuild yang cocok dengan versi modul utama Essentials/EssentialsX Anda (modul ini diterbitkan sebagai addon Essentials/EssentialsX).
- Letakkan file
.jarmodul ke direktoriplugins/server Anda bersama plugin Essentials/EssentialsX utama. - Mulai ulang server dan periksa console server untuk memastikan modul telah dimuat.
📦 Dependensi
- EssentialsX (versi yang cocok dari modul utama) — diperlukan karena modul ini bergantung pada paket utama.
- Vault — direkomendasikan/digunakan oleh EssentialsX untuk interaksi ekonomi/izin.
- Plugin permissions (contoh: LuckPerms) — diperlukan untuk mengelola node izin item/blok secara efektif.
🧾 Konfigurasi
- AntiBuild menggunakan bagian konfigurasi blacklist dan alert tempat Anda mencantumkan item yang diblokir/di-alert berdasarkan ID (legacy) atau berdasarkan nama item pada versi Minecraft modern.
- Kunci config standar mencakup
blacklist.placement,blacklist.usage,blacklist.break,blacklist.pistondanalert.on-placement,alert.on-use,alert.on-break. - Modul ini mengekspos pola izin
essentials.build.*untuk kontrol yang lebih terperinci.
🧠 Catatan Teknis
- Modul ini tetap mendukung ID numerik secara legacy, tetapi menggunakan nama item pada Minecraft 1.13+.
- Pastikan kompatibilitas platform dan versi dengan build modul yang Anda unduh; build EssentialsX modern mencantumkan versi Minecraft yang didukung secara spesifik.
- AntiBuild disediakan sebagai modul dalam ekosistem Essentials/EssentialsX, bukan plugin monolitik mandiri.
🤝 Kapan Plugin Ini Berguna
Jika Anda membutuhkan kontrol yang presisi dan berbasis izin atas item dan blok mana yang dapat diinteraksikan pemain (misalnya untuk mencegah griefing atau membatasi blok yang berdampak pada server), AntiBuild memungkinkan Anda menegakkan aturan tersebut secara terpusat melalui izin dan blacklist sambil tetap terintegrasi dengan pengaturan Essentials/EssentialsX yang sudah ada.
- Verre de Lait
Server 100% vanilla (Survival & Freebuild) berfokus komunitas, dengan voice chat, aturan jelas, dan dunia Skyland — pengalaman santai dan kooperatif.
239.24 - GameHaus Light
Server Survival ramah dengan zona PvP dan boss kustom, dunia multiverse dan dukungan Discord aktif.
030.87 - Welcome to Dragon's Nest!025.21
- L'oasis que vous méritez022.35
- LiminalDream022.29
- Welcome to Sanacraft022.23
- BTE Japan021.88
- Big Bang Gamers | MineCraft019.61
- A Minecraft Server06.32
- Wabbles.de05.65
- Craftopia05.6
Halaman plugin EssentialsAntiBuild menampilkan di server mana monitoring menemukan plugin ini, dengan platform dan versi apa ia ditemukan.
Plugin dapat menambahkan perintah, ekonomi, perlindungan, hak akses, mini-game, integrasi, atau mekanik lainnya. Peran sebenarnya dari EssentialsAntiBuild bergantung pada konfigurasi server yang bersangkutan.
Data terbentuk otomatis dari respons teknis server. Jika server menyembunyikan daftar plugin, server tersebut mungkin tidak muncul di bagian ini meskipun menggunakan EssentialsAntiBuild.
Gunakan daftar server dengan EssentialsAntiBuild untuk membandingkan proyek, memeriksa versi yang kompatibel, atau menemukan contoh penggunaan plugin di server publik.